A lesson designed for higher ability GCSE students enabling them to provide balanced and justified comments about changes to their timetable. They build up gradually by comparing the 2 timetables provided justifying their preferences by using comparatives & superlatives. Recap of the formation of the conditional tense so as to suggest possible improvements/changes to their own timetable. Opportunity for spontaneous use of language by agreeing é justifying their comments always with the aim of responding in enough detail to gain the highest bands of marks for communication é range. Markscheme is for WJEC CAS - Structured conversation but can be easily amended to suit another board's criteria.
